broiled ginger lamb chops

I combined two old recipes to make these they came out tender and flavorful:)

prep time 10 Min
cook time 20 Min
method ---
yield 4 to 6

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ons salad oil
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ons ground ginger
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 tablespoons dijon style mustard
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me leaves
  • 1 teaspoon pepper
  • 6 - lamb loin chops

How To Make broiled ginger lamb chops

  • Step 1
    preheat broiler then mix all ingredients except chops in small mixing bowl.
  • Step 2
    brush chops with mustard mixture place chops on greased or (nonstick olive oil) broiler pan
  • Step 3
    broil 6 to 7 minutes, turn and brush other side and broil another 6 to 7 minutes. this takes about a total of 16 minutes depending on chop size. I broiled them one more minute each side and had put broth and water in underneath of broiler pan. they came out moist and tender and flavorful
  • Step 4
    put a teaspoon of mint jelly on top of each chop while still hot or put mint jelly on side for dipping
